What happens:
We uses Adobe Reader from the partner repository. However, we don't want to use
the firefox plugin to view PDF inline. We cannot remove the nspluginwrapper
without breaking acroread package.
What would be nice:
If nspluginwrapper and nspluginviewer were suggested or recommended, we would
be able to do that.
